"""Per-file coverage threshold validation for quality-managed modules."""
from __future__ import annotations
import xml.etree.ElementTree as ET
from dataclasses import dataclass
from pathlib import Path
from typing import Any
@dataclass(frozen=True)
class CoverageRates:
"""Line and branch percentages reported for one source file."""
line: float
branch: float | None
def _load_percentages(xml_path: Path, root: Path) -> dict[str, CoverageRates]:
"""Load per-file line and branch percentages from a Cobertura report."""
tree = ET.parse(xml_path)
xml_root = tree.getroot()
source_roots = [
Path(node.text) for node in xml_root.findall("./sources/source") if node.text
]
percentages: dict[str, CoverageRates] = {}
for class_node in xml_root.findall(".//class"):
filename = class_node.attrib.get("filename")
line_rate = class_node.attrib.get("line-rate")
branch_rate = class_node.attrib.get("branch-rate")
if not filename or line_rate is None:
continue
normalized = filename.replace("\\", "/")
if normalized.startswith("/"):
key = Path(normalized).relative_to(root).as_posix()
else:
key = normalized
for source_root in source_roots:
candidate = source_root / filename
if candidate.exists():
key = candidate.relative_to(root).as_posix()
break
percentages[key] = CoverageRates(
line=float(line_rate) * 100.0,
branch=float(branch_rate) * 100.0 if branch_rate is not None else None,
)
return percentages
def run_check(contract: dict[str, Any], root: Path, xml_path: Path) -> list[str]:
"""Return human-readable issues for tracked files below the coverage floor.
The report is intentionally per-file so a single weak module cannot hide
behind aggregate suite coverage.
"""
if not xml_path.exists():
return [f"coverage xml missing: {xml_path.relative_to(root)}"]
percentages = _load_percentages(xml_path, root)
minimum = float(contract.get("coverage", {}).get("minimum_percent", 95.0))
coverage_contract = contract.get("coverage", {})
branch_minimum = coverage_contract.get("minimum_branch_percent")
if branch_minimum is not None:
branch_minimum = float(branch_minimum)
branch_tracked = {
path.replace("\\", "/")
for path in coverage_contract.get(
"branch_tracked_files",
coverage_contract.get("tracked_files", [])
if branch_minimum is not None
else [],
)
}
issues: list[str] = []
for relative_path in contract.get("coverage", {}).get("tracked_files", []):
normalized = relative_path.replace("\\", "/")
rates = percentages.get(normalized)
if rates is None:
issues.append(f"coverage missing for tracked file: {relative_path}")
continue
if rates.line + 1e-9 < minimum:
issues.append(
f"coverage below {minimum:.1f}%: {relative_path} ({rates.line:.1f}%)"
)
if branch_minimum is None or normalized not in branch_tracked:
continue
if rates.branch is None:
issues.append(f"branch coverage missing for tracked file: {relative_path}")
elif rates.branch + 1e-9 < branch_minimum:
issues.append(
"branch coverage below "
f"{branch_minimum:.1f}%: {relative_path} ({rates.branch:.1f}%)"
)
return issues
def compute_workspace_line_coverage(
contract: dict[str, Any],
root: Path,
xml_path: Path,
) -> float:
"""Compute mean line coverage across tracked files present in the XML."""
if not xml_path.exists():
return 0.0
percentages = _load_percentages(xml_path, root)
samples: list[float] = []
for relative_path in contract.get("coverage", {}).get("tracked_files", []):
normalized = relative_path.replace("\\", "/")
rates = percentages.get(normalized)
if rates is not None:
samples.append(rates.line)
if not samples:
return 0.0
return round(sum(samples) / len(samples), 3)
